![]() |
![]() |
![]() |
Conglomerate Programmer's Reference Manual | ![]() |
---|---|---|---|---|
Top | Description | Object Hierarchy | Signals |
#define DEBUG_EDITOR_AREA_LIFETIMES CongEditorArea; #define CONG_EDITOR_AREA (obj) #define CONG_EDITOR_AREA_CLASS (klass) #define IS_CONG_EDITOR_AREA (obj) gboolean (*CongEditorAreaCallbackFunc) (CongEditorArea *editor_area
,gpointer user_data
); GType cong_editor_area_get_type (void
); CongEditorArea * cong_editor_area_construct (CongEditorArea *area
,CongEditorWidget3 *editor_widget
); CongEditorWidget3 * cong_editor_area_get_widget (CongEditorArea *area
); CongDocument * cong_editor_area_get_document (CongEditorArea *area
); gboolean cong_editor_area_is_hidden (CongEditorArea *area
); void cong_editor_area_show (CongEditorArea *area
); void cong_editor_area_hide (CongEditorArea *area
); GtkStateType cong_editor_area_get_state (CongEditorArea *editor_area
); void cong_editor_area_set_state (CongEditorArea *editor_area
,GtkStateType state
); GdkCursor * cong_editor_area_get_cursor (CongEditorArea *area
); void cong_editor_area_set_cursor (CongEditorArea *area
,GdkCursor *cursor
); const GdkRectangle * cong_editor_area_get_window_coords (CongEditorArea *area
); guint cong_editor_area_get_requisition (CongEditorArea *area
,GtkOrientation orientation
,int width_hint
); gint cong_editor_area_get_requisition_width (CongEditorArea *area
,int width_hint
); gint cong_editor_area_get_requisition_height (CongEditorArea *area
,int width_hint
); gint cong_editor_area_get_cached_requisition (CongEditorArea *area
,GtkOrientation orientation
); void cong_editor_area_debug_render_area (CongEditorArea *area
,GdkGC *gc
); void cong_editor_area_debug_render_state (CongEditorArea *area
); CongEditorArea * cong_editor_area_get_parent (CongEditorArea *area
); void cong_editor_area_recursive_render (CongEditorArea *area
,const GdkRectangle *widget_rect
); gboolean cong_editor_area_on_button_press (CongEditorArea *editor_area
,GdkEventButton *event
); gboolean cong_editor_area_on_motion_notify (CongEditorArea *editor_area
,GdkEventMotion *event
); gboolean cong_editor_area_on_key_press (CongEditorArea *editor_area
,GdkEventKey *event
); guint cong_editor_area_calc_requisition (CongEditorArea *editor_area
,GtkOrientation orientation
,int width_hint
); gint cong_editor_area_calc_requisition_width (CongEditorArea *editor_area
,int width_hint
); gint cong_editor_area_calc_requisition_height (CongEditorArea *editor_area
,int width_hint
); void cong_editor_area_set_allocation (CongEditorArea *editor_area
,gint x
,gint y
,gint width
,gint height
); void cong_editor_area_queue_redraw (CongEditorArea *editor_area
); void cong_editor_area_flush_requisition_cache (CongEditorArea *editor_area
,GtkOrientation orientation
); CongEditorArea * cong_editor_area_for_all (CongEditorArea *editor_area
,CongEditorAreaCallbackFunc func
,gpointer user_data
); CongEditorArea * cong_editor_area_recurse (CongEditorArea *editor_area
,CongEditorAreaCallbackFunc pre_func
,CongEditorAreaCallbackFunc post_func
,gpointer user_data
); gboolean cong_editor_area_covers_xy (CongEditorArea *editor_area
,gint x
,gint y
); CongEditorArea * cong_editor_area_get_immediate_child_at (CongEditorArea *area
,gint x
,gint y
); CongEditorArea * cong_editor_area_get_deepest_child_at (CongEditorArea *area
,gint x
,gint y
); GdkWindow * cong_editor_area_get_gdk_window (CongEditorArea *editor_area
); void cong_editor_area_connect_node_signals (CongEditorArea *area
,CongEditorNode *editor_node
); void cong_editor_area_protected_postprocess_add_internal_child (CongEditorArea *area
,CongEditorArea *internal_child
); void cong_editor_area_protected_set_parent (CongEditorArea *area
,CongEditorArea *parent
);
GObject +----CongEditorArea +----CongEditorAreaContainer +----CongEditorAreaExpander +----CongEditorAreaPixbuf +----CongEditorAreaSpacer +----CongEditorAreaText +----CongEditorAreaTextFragment +----CongEditorAreaUnderline
"button-press-event" : Run Last "children-changed" : Run First "flush-requisition-cache" : Run First "key-press-event" : Run Last "motion-notify-event" : Run Last "state-changed" : Run Last "width-changed" : Run Last
#define CONG_EDITOR_AREA(obj) G_TYPE_CHECK_INSTANCE_CAST (obj, CONG_EDITOR_AREA_TYPE, CongEditorArea)
|
#define CONG_EDITOR_AREA_CLASS(klass) G_TYPE_CHECK_CLASS_CAST (klass, CONG_EDITOR_AREA_TYPE, CongEditorAreaClass)
|
#define IS_CONG_EDITOR_AREA(obj) G_TYPE_CHECK_INSTANCE_TYPE (obj, CONG_EDITOR_AREA_TYPE)
|
gboolean (*CongEditorAreaCallbackFunc) (CongEditorArea *editor_area
,gpointer user_data
);
|
|
|
|
Returns : |
CongEditorArea * cong_editor_area_construct (CongEditorArea *area
,CongEditorWidget3 *editor_widget
);
TODO: Write me
Returns : |
CongEditorWidget3 * cong_editor_area_get_widget (CongEditorArea *area
);
TODO: Write me
Returns : |
CongDocument * cong_editor_area_get_document (CongEditorArea *area
);
TODO: Write me
Returns : |
gboolean cong_editor_area_is_hidden (CongEditorArea *area
);
TODO: Write me
Returns : |
GtkStateType cong_editor_area_get_state (CongEditorArea *editor_area
);
TODO: Write me
Returns : |
void cong_editor_area_set_state (CongEditorArea *editor_area
,GtkStateType state
);
TODO: Write me
GdkCursor * cong_editor_area_get_cursor (CongEditorArea *area
);
TODO: Write me
Returns : |
void cong_editor_area_set_cursor (CongEditorArea *area
,GdkCursor *cursor
);
TODO: Write me
const GdkRectangle * cong_editor_area_get_window_coords (CongEditorArea *area
);
TODO: Write me
Returns : |
guint cong_editor_area_get_requisition (CongEditorArea *area
,GtkOrientation orientation
,int width_hint
);
TODO: Write me
Returns : |
gint cong_editor_area_get_requisition_width (CongEditorArea *area
,int width_hint
);
TODO: Write me
Returns : |
gint cong_editor_area_get_requisition_height (CongEditorArea *area
,int width_hint
);
TODO: Write me
Returns : |
gint cong_editor_area_get_cached_requisition (CongEditorArea *area
,GtkOrientation orientation
);
TODO: Write me
Returns : |
void cong_editor_area_debug_render_area (CongEditorArea *area
,GdkGC *gc
);
TODO: Write me
void cong_editor_area_debug_render_state (CongEditorArea *area
);
TODO: Write me
CongEditorArea * cong_editor_area_get_parent (CongEditorArea *area
);
TODO: Write me
Returns : |
void cong_editor_area_recursive_render (CongEditorArea *area
,const GdkRectangle *widget_rect
);
TODO: Write me
gboolean cong_editor_area_on_button_press (CongEditorArea *editor_area
,GdkEventButton *event
);
TODO: Write me
Returns : |
gboolean cong_editor_area_on_motion_notify (CongEditorArea *editor_area
,GdkEventMotion *event
);
TODO: Write me
Returns : |
gboolean cong_editor_area_on_key_press (CongEditorArea *editor_area
,GdkEventKey *event
);
TODO: Write me
Returns : |
guint cong_editor_area_calc_requisition (CongEditorArea *editor_area
,GtkOrientation orientation
,int width_hint
);
TODO: Write me
Returns : |
gint cong_editor_area_calc_requisition_width (CongEditorArea *editor_area
,int width_hint
);
|
|
|
|
Returns : |
gint cong_editor_area_calc_requisition_height (CongEditorArea *editor_area
,int width_hint
);
|
|
|
|
Returns : |
void cong_editor_area_set_allocation (CongEditorArea *editor_area
,gint x
,gint y
,gint width
,gint height
);
TODO: Write me
void cong_editor_area_queue_redraw (CongEditorArea *editor_area
);
TODO: Write me
void cong_editor_area_flush_requisition_cache (CongEditorArea *editor_area
,GtkOrientation orientation
);
TODO: Write me
CongEditorArea * cong_editor_area_for_all (CongEditorArea *editor_area
,CongEditorAreaCallbackFunc func
,gpointer user_data
);
TODO: Write me
Returns : |
CongEditorArea * cong_editor_area_recurse (CongEditorArea *editor_area
,CongEditorAreaCallbackFunc pre_func
,CongEditorAreaCallbackFunc post_func
,gpointer user_data
);
|
|
|
|
|
|
|
|
Returns : |
gboolean cong_editor_area_covers_xy (CongEditorArea *editor_area
,gint x
,gint y
);
TODO: Write me
Returns : |
CongEditorArea * cong_editor_area_get_immediate_child_at (CongEditorArea *area
,gint x
,gint y
);
TODO: Write me
Returns : |
CongEditorArea * cong_editor_area_get_deepest_child_at (CongEditorArea *area
,gint x
,gint y
);
TODO: Write me
Returns : |
GdkWindow * cong_editor_area_get_gdk_window (CongEditorArea *editor_area
);
TODO: Write me
Returns : |
void cong_editor_area_connect_node_signals (CongEditorArea *area
,CongEditorNode *editor_node
);
TODO: Write me
void cong_editor_area_protected_postprocess_add_internal_child (CongEditorArea *area
,CongEditorArea *internal_child
);
TODO: Write me
void cong_editor_area_protected_set_parent (CongEditorArea *area
,CongEditorArea *parent
);
TODO: Write me
"button-press-event"
signalgboolean user_function (CongEditorArea *congeditorarea, gpointer arg1, gpointer user_data) : Run Last
|
the object which received the signal. |
|
|
|
user data set when the signal handler was connected. |
Returns : |
"children-changed"
signalvoid user_function (CongEditorArea *congeditorarea, gpointer user_data) : Run First
|
the object which received the signal. |
|
user data set when the signal handler was connected. |
"flush-requisition-cache"
signalvoid user_function (CongEditorArea *congeditorarea, GtkOrientation arg1, gpointer user_data) : Run First
|
the object which received the signal. |
|
|
|
user data set when the signal handler was connected. |
"key-press-event"
signalgboolean user_function (CongEditorArea *congeditorarea, gpointer arg1, gpointer user_data) : Run Last
|
the object which received the signal. |
|
|
|
user data set when the signal handler was connected. |
Returns : |
"motion-notify-event"
signalgboolean user_function (CongEditorArea *congeditorarea, gpointer arg1, gpointer user_data) : Run Last
|
the object which received the signal. |
|
|
|
user data set when the signal handler was connected. |
Returns : |
"state-changed"
signalvoid user_function (CongEditorArea *congeditorarea, gpointer user_data) : Run Last
|
the object which received the signal. |
|
user data set when the signal handler was connected. |
"width-changed"
signalvoid user_function (CongEditorArea *congeditorarea, gpointer user_data) : Run Last
|
the object which received the signal. |
|
user data set when the signal handler was connected. |